Toyota Voxy ZS Petrol Cars
The Toyota Voxy ZS Petrol is a versatile and spacious MPV (multi-purpose vehicle) that has increasingly caught the attention of families and fleet drivers in the United Kingdom. Though primarily designed for markets such as Japan, where its boxy silhouette and practical layout are highly appreciated, the Voxy offers qualities that make it well-suited for UK roads and driving conditions.
Under the bonnet, the Voxy ZS typically features a 2.0-litre petrol engine that delivers a smooth balance of power and efficiency—ideal for both urban environments and longer motorway journeys. This naturally aspirated engine produces around 150 horsepower, providing sufficient acceleration to safely merge onto busy UK motorways such as the M25 or M1 without feeling strained. The engine’s petrol configuration ensures relatively straightforward servicing across most UK dealerships, along with good parts availability.
One of the most compelling aspects of the Toyota Voxy ZS Petrol is its interior space and flexibility. Its boxy design maximises cabin volume within its compact external dimensions, making it an excellent choice for larger families or anyone needing extra cargo room on weekend trips to destinations like the Lake District or coastal Cornwall. Seating up to seven passengers with a configurable 3-row layout, passengers enjoy ample headroom—a rare comfort given lower garage heights often found on British residential streets. Additionally, flat-folding seats allow owners to adapt quickly from passenger-hauling mode to generous load-carrying capacity suitable for bulky items.
In terms of handling and ride comfort on typical UK road surfaces, from London’s pothole-pocked city streets to winding rural lanes in Wales or Scotland, the Toyota Voxy excels at absorbing bumps without harshness while maintaining stable body control through corners. Its modest size relative to other seven-seat people carriers means manoeuvring through narrow country roads or tight town centre parking spots is less daunting than bulkier rivals.
Safety features fitted to the ZS grade enhance confidence on unpredictable wet-weather days common across much of Britain; advanced braking systems coupled with traction control provide sure-footed stability even when roads become slick from rain. Visibility is also good thanks to large windows and an elevated driving position—important when negotiating multi-lane roundabouts or pedestrian-heavy zones often encountered in cities like Manchester or Birmingham.
